Here is the question again… • Applying for a Summer Job • Read about the situation below and complete the assignment that follows. • The Situation • Imagine that you are Kim Green, a Grade 9 student applying for one of the four jobs listed • below. Robin Thornton is the person at the Hillcrest Job Centre who processes the • applications for these jobs.

  12. Summer Jobs Available • Volunteer Jobs • • Playground Program Assistant—assist with activities for seven- to ten-year old • children • • Senior Citizens’ Assistant—assist with the needs and activities of seniors in a • centre or in the community

  13. Paid Jobs • • Fast Food Restaurant Employee—prepare food, serve customers, clear tables • • Landscaping Assistant—plant flowers and shrubs; cut and rake lawns • Assignment • Write a business letter to Robin Thornton in which you apply for the job you have selected. (Select only one job from the list above.) • When writing, be sure to

  14. • identify the job for which you are applying • • explain what knowledge, skills, or experience you have that may be relevant to the job • • sign your letter Kim Green—do not sign your own name • • organize your thoughts appropriately in sentences and paragraphs • • use vocabulary that is appropriate and effective
